Core Insights - The article highlights the increasing popularity of ice and snow tourism during the 2026 New Year holiday, with various cultural and recreational activities being organized across different regions in China [1][9]. Group 1: Ice and Snow Activities - In Chifeng City, Inner Mongolia, a series of ice and snow-themed cultural tourism activities are being held, including traditional performances and food markets, creating a festive atmosphere for visitors [1][3]. - The Chifeng Ice and Snow Carnival features 12 groups of intangible cultural heritage performances and a spectacular fireworks display, enhancing the celebratory mood [3][9]. - From January 1 to March, Chifeng will host 72 activities across nine themes, ensuring a continuous festive experience for tourists [9]. Group 2: Popularity of Tourism Routes - Beijing's cultural and tourism bureau has launched 10 ice and snow cultural tourism routes, which have gained significant popularity during the New Year holiday [9][15]. - The "Snow Drift" experience at the National Stadium (Bird's Nest) has seen improvements in slope, length, and area compared to previous years, making it one of the most favored attractions [12][14]. Group 3: Visitor Statistics and Experience Enhancements - In Shennongjia, the number of visitors engaging in skiing and snow appreciation reached 18,000 on New Year's Day, marking a year-on-year increase of approximately 112.6% [18]. - To enhance visitor experience, Shennongjia has upgraded night skiing experiences and introduced various themed light displays and interactive activities [23][25]. - The introduction of "scenic area + skiing" and "theater + skiing" packages has stimulated the local winter tourism market [25].
